Understanding Positions: The Different Functions of a listing agent and a buyers agent



Inside the real estate sector, professionals often specialize in serving either property owners or purchasers. Understanding the difference between a listing agent and a buyers agent is crucial for a successful transaction. Both kinds of real estate agent plays a specific and vital part in the process. Let's look at a few key distinctions:


  • A listing agent primarily represents the seller, aiming to promote the property effectively and get the best possible price and terms.

  • Conversely, a buyers agent solely represents the purchaser, supporting them to locate a fitting property and negotiate its purchase.}

  • The listing agent oversees responsibilities like market analysis, creating advertisements, conducting viewings, and handling bids on behalf of the seller.

  • A buyers agent delivers clients with information on homes for sale, schedules tours, guides on making an offer, and helps with inspections.

  • Both the listing agent and the buyers agent are typically compensated through a percentage of the sale price that is paid from the seller's proceeds at closing, though specific arrangements can vary.


Essentially, both types of realtor work diligently to ensure a favorable real estate deal for their respective clients. Selecting the correct type of real estate agent is determined by whether you are marketing or acquiring property.

Selecting Your Partner: Important Factors for Engaging a real estate agent



Choosing the perfect real estate agent is a fundamental move in your housing quest. This individual will be your partner, so it's essential to find someone who grasps your requirements and you can trust. Evaluate their experience, particularly with properties similar to yours in your area. A knowledgeable realtor should demonstrate comprehensive understanding of local price trends and proven deal-making abilities. Feel free to request testimonials from past clients to understand their level of service. Furthermore, ensure they are officially registered and are members of recognized real estate organizations, which often indicates adherence to a strict code of ethics, whether they are a listing agent or a buyers agent. Finally, a great real estate agent will communicate effectively, be initiative-taking, and strive diligently to meet your goals.

  • Q: How does a buyers agent differ from a listing agent?

    A: A buyers agent represents the buyer in a real estate transaction, supporting them identify a property and bargain the purchase on their behalf. Conversely, a listing agent, also known as a seller's agent, assists the property owner. The listing agent focuses on marketing the property and securing the highest price and terms for the seller. Both are types of real estate agent or realtor, but their loyalties belong to their respective clients in the transaction.
